How they compare
Japan currently reports 337 1000 USD against 227 1000 USD in Ghana, a difference of 110 1000 USD.
That makes Japan's figure about 1.5 times Ghana's.
Across all 7 years both countries report, Japan has been ahead every year.
Ghana ranks 3rd and Japan ranks 1st of 51 countries.
Japan has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

About this data
The database contains data on the bilateral trade flows in roundwood, prim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world. The main types of primary forest products included in are: ro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further. The definitions are available.
